[Commits] [SCM] claws branch, gtk3, updated. 3.16.0-850-gcbd1fb9ea

paul at claws-mail.org paul at claws-mail.org
Fri Nov 22 10:27:47 CET 2019


The branch, gtk3 has been updated
       via  cbd1fb9ea393a51e8340620c2800ee7130e4cd03 (commit)
      from  2053f301428b2ebfafde1551800911700432ddcc (commit)

Summary of changes:
 src/gtk/gtkutils.c | 11 +++++------
 1 file changed, 5 insertions(+), 6 deletions(-)


- Log -----------------------------------------------------------------
commit cbd1fb9ea393a51e8340620c2800ee7130e4cd03
Author: paul <paul at claws-mail.org>
Date:   Fri Nov 22 10:27:41 2019 +0000

    replace deprecated gtk_widget_set_state()

diff --git a/src/gtk/gtkutils.c b/src/gtk/gtkutils.c
index 063bb4c7a..a9e710c16 100644
--- a/src/gtk/gtkutils.c
+++ b/src/gtk/gtkutils.c
@@ -1203,8 +1203,7 @@ static void link_btn_enter(GtkButton *button, gpointer data)
 		gdk_window_set_cursor(gdkwin, hand_cursor);
 
 	gtk_button_set_relief(button, GTK_RELIEF_NONE);
-	gtk_widget_set_state(GTK_WIDGET(button), GTK_STATE_NORMAL);
-	
+	gtk_widget_set_state_flags(GTK_WIDGET(button), GTK_STATE_FLAG_NORMAL, TRUE);
 }
 
 static void link_btn_leave(GtkButton *button, gpointer data)
@@ -1218,26 +1217,26 @@ static void link_btn_leave(GtkButton *button, gpointer data)
 		gdk_window_set_cursor(gdkwin, NULL);
 
 	gtk_button_set_relief(button, GTK_RELIEF_NONE);
-	gtk_widget_set_state(GTK_WIDGET(button), GTK_STATE_NORMAL);
+	gtk_widget_set_state_flags(GTK_WIDGET(button), GTK_STATE_FLAG_NORMAL, TRUE);
 }
 
 static void link_btn_pressed(GtkButton *button, gpointer data)
 {
 	gtk_button_set_relief(button, GTK_RELIEF_NONE);
-	gtk_widget_set_state(GTK_WIDGET(button), GTK_STATE_NORMAL);
+	gtk_widget_set_state_flags(GTK_WIDGET(button), GTK_STATE_FLAG_NORMAL, TRUE);
 }
 
 static void link_btn_released(GtkButton *button, gpointer data)
 {
 	gtk_button_set_relief(button, GTK_RELIEF_NONE);
-	gtk_widget_set_state(GTK_WIDGET(button), GTK_STATE_NORMAL);
+	gtk_widget_set_state_flags(GTK_WIDGET(button), GTK_STATE_FLAG_NORMAL, TRUE);
 }
 
 static void link_btn_clicked(GtkButton *button, gpointer data)
 {
 	gchar *url = (gchar *)data;
 	gtk_button_set_relief(button, GTK_RELIEF_NONE);
-	gtk_widget_set_state(GTK_WIDGET(button), GTK_STATE_NORMAL);
+	gtk_widget_set_state_flags(GTK_WIDGET(button), GTK_STATE_FLAG_NORMAL, TRUE);
 	open_uri(url, prefs_common_get_uri_cmd());
 }
 

-----------------------------------------------------------------------


hooks/post-receive
-- 
Claws Mail


More information about the Commits mailing list